Trip Report: Qantas Airways QF559 Brisbane to Sydney
Flight Details:
Airline: Qantas Registration: VH-VYI "Bathurst Island" Aircraft: Boeing 737-838 Departure Brisbane Terminal D: 7:55PM Arrival Sydney: 10:30PM Total time : 1 hours 20 mins Distance : Total time : 1 hours 20 mins Distance : 623Kms or 387 miles
Introduction
This 2014 trip is the return flight to Sydney after watching the Rugby 7 games in Gold Coast. Had flown on Tiger Airways to Gold Coast, Read Trip Report: Sydney - Gold Coast on TigerAir
TRain RidE to Airport
I arrived at Robina Station to catch train at 3:43 pm
Express train depart from Gold Coast to Brisbane Airport.
Train Ride Video
Watch the video to enjoy the train ride.
Train takes 2 h 7 min from Robina to Brisbane Airport.
Arrived at Brisbane Domestic Airport by 5:25 pm.
Check-In and Security
As I was carrying only a handbag, which was light, didn't take long to receive the boarding card. After receiving the boarding card, I headed upstair to clear security. Security queue was short and soon was in the departure area.

Boarding
Flight being prepared to operate to Sydney.
Flight boarding was to commence from Gate 25.. Passengers boarding card was checked before being allowed to enter the aircarft.
Crew at the door to receive passengers.
Cabin view
Soon after entering the aircraft, I followed the seat number to the assigned window seat. The glass was not clear, hence no videos.
Pushback and Departure
Doors were closed after all passengers had boarded the flight and sat in assigned seats. Safety demonstration was conducted from the drop down monitors.
Pushback commenced and after a short taxi headed towards runway.
Crew conducting safety check.
Seating
Seating on the Boeing 737-800 are 3-3 in economy. Seat were made of cloth.
Seat Pocket Material
Seat pocket contained the safety card, sickness bag and inflight magazine.
Qantas Boeing 737-800 Safety card
Inflight magazine
Seat entertainment controls in arm rest. No headphones were distributed.
Entertainment was through drop down panel.
Snack Service
Snack service started after achieving cruising height
Cookies with tea or coffee was offered to all passengers
Seat view
Seat spacing was adequate for me.
Window view
The glass was not clear with scratch marks. It being dark outside there wasn't much to view outside.
Arrival in Sydney
Soon it was landing time, Cabin crew cleared the snack rubbish. Captain came on mic and announced were are on approach towards Sydney. Heading from North, flight landed on runway 16R. After landing, a short taxi to Qantas terminal to arrive at disembarkation gate.
